본문 바로가기

ajax

[jQuery] ajax 사용시 Parameter 처리방법 주의점 // data으로 Parameter 전송 var Parms = '?mode=login'; Parms += '&code=' + code; Parms += '&uid=' + uid; Parms += '&pass=' + pass; $.ajax({ url: '/member/memberAction.asp', type: 'post', //post,get,등..전송방식 dataType: 'text',//데이타 타입 data: { mode : "login", code : code, uid : uid, pass : pass }, success: function(data){ } // url에 이어서 전송 $.ajax({ url: '/member/memberAction.asp'+Parms, type: 'post', data.. 더보기
[jQuery] aJax 의 간단한 예제 ajax 간단한 예제 Parameter를 직접 넘기기 $.ajax({ type: "POST", dataType: "text", url: "/action.asp", data: { mode : "INSERT" , name: val.value}, success: function(data){ if (data == "OK") { val.value = ""; } } ,error: function(){ alert(" html Load error!!"); } }); Form submit 하기 $.ajax({ type: "POST", dataType: "text", url: "/action.asp", data: $("#form_id").serialize(), success: function(data){ if (data .. 더보기
[jQuery] ajax 옵션 $.ajax({ type: "POST" //"POST", "GET" , async: true //true, false , url: "/common/response.jsp" //Request URL //, dataType : "html" //전송받을 데이터의 타입 "xml", "html", "script", "json" 등 지정 가능 미지정시 자동 판단 , timeout: 30000 //제한시간 지정 , cache: false //true, false , data: 'a=asdf' //$("#inputForm").serialize() //서버에 보낼 파라메터, form에 serialize() 실행시 a=b&c=d 형태로 생성되며 한글은 UTF-8 방식으로 인코딩 "a=b&c=d" 문자열로 직접 입력 가능 .. 더보기

반응형